NAPLPS is an image file format developed as part of an effort to build a way to quickly transmit graphic images, and began to be used in the 1980s, mainly in the Canadian broadcasting industry.

GraphicConverter converts pictures to different formats and has tools for picture manipulation. With it you can import about 200 graphic file formats and export approximately 80 graphic file formats.
